Who taught you to play drums?

In the mid '60s, there was a band in our town called The Yardleys. They were like the Beatles to us. They were seniors when I was a freshman, and they had a drummer named Bucky Griggs who played a red sparkle Ludwig kit. I coveted that kit. He was like Ringo [Starr] ... He taught me how to do a couple of things. My first real drum kit was a red sparkle Ludwig kit, just like his.
